Safety, Licensing, and Fair Play
Online casino safety in New Zealand is a topic that deserves careful attention. While NZ does not issue its own online casino licenses to offshore operators, platforms like Spin Galaxy typically operate under international licensing arrangements. The exact licensing body and licence number should be visible in the footer of the official Spin Galaxy website — always check there for the most current information before you deposit.
Fair play is another critical area. Spin Galaxy uses random number generator (RNG) software to determine game outcomes, which is standard practice across reputable online casinos. The RNG is typically tested and certified by independent audit firms, though the specific auditors will be listed on the operator’s site if you want to verify.
KYC (Know Your Customer) verification is standard here. You’ll need to provide proof of identity and address before your first withdrawal is processed. This is a normal security step, not a red flag. What you should watch for is whether the casino makes the process straightforward or burdensome — a well-run KYC flow takes a few hours, not several weeks.
For players under 18, Spin Galaxy is off-limits. Online gambling in New Zealand is restricted to adults, and the casino’s terms reflect that. Always gamble within your means and treat any casino visit as entertainment, not a way to make money.

Common Mistakes
Depositing without checking the minimum amount required for the bonus is a frequent slip. Players assume any deposit qualifies, only to find they missed the threshold by a few dollars.
Another common error is playing high-volatility slots with a small bankroll and a short session. High-volatility games can drain your balance quickly if you’re not prepared for the swings.
Ignoring the KYC process until you request a withdrawal is perhaps the most costly mistake. Verification delays are the #1 reason for slow payouts, and completing it early makes the process painless.
